From September 2000 to January 2001, airborne fungi were isolated from the building of the Clinical Analyses laboratories, including its didactic and research rooms, in Araraquara São Paulo State, Brazil, by using Andersen, MAS-100® (MERCK) machine, with Sabouraud chloramphenicol medium. After 5 days of incubation at 25°C, the colonies of the fungi were counted, resulting in the identification of 21 taxa. Cladophialophora spp. was the most isolated in internal and external environments as well, followed by Penicillium spp. and Mycelia spp. In accordance with the resolution n° 9, January 2003 (ANVISA), fungi considered unacceptable were found in nine internal environments and one of these presented the amount of fungi above of the acceptable limit. Among the obtained fungi, at least 16 taxa were reported as opportunistic, nine were related to plant diseases and seven were associated to allergy problems.

Objective: To evaluate the biosecurity measures adopted in dental prosthesis laboratories of the city of João Pessoa, PB, Brazil with respect to prosthetic works sent by dentists. Method: Twenty-five dental prosthesis technicians (DPT) of the city of João Pessoa, PB, filled out a questionnaire referring to their knowledge of the biosecurity principles, disinfection of impressions and other prosthetic items, and the use of individual protection equipment (IPE). Results: Although 92% of the interviewees believed in the possible occurrence of cross-infection between dental prosthesis laboratories and dental offices, 64% declared that the prosthetic works received in their laboratories do not undergo any disinfection procedure. It was also observed that, for disinfection of impressions and stone casts, the chemical substances are not used as recommended by the manufacturers or are innocuous to microorganisms. Regarding the use of IPE, 60% of the DPT used mask, but only 4% used gowns. With respect to the measures taken regarding the impressions received from dental offices, 56% of the interviewees only wash them in running tap water, and 56% of the stone casts that arrive at the laboratory are not disinfected in any way. Conclusion: There is a need for more motivation and instructions to DPT regarding the prevention of cross-contamination during sending and receiving of prosthetic works between dental prosthesis laboratories and dental offices because the DPT evaluated in this study were found negligent with respect to disinfection procedures.
